Nature, attractions, sport and gastronomy: the Veneto Dolomites hide a tourist resort that lives both in summer and winter. We are talking about Selva di Cadore. Let’s get to know it better. Selva di Cadore is a town in the Val Fiorentina formed by several hamlets and is a real pearl of the Dolomites of Belluno. This valley is inserted in the frame of the gigantic Dolomites (Mount Pelmo, Mount Civetta and part of the Marmolada) and the Group Croda da Lago – Cernera.
How high is Selva di Cadore? It is located at an altitude of more than a thousand and three hundred meters and its location is strategic because it offers a breathtaking view and various attractions at all times of the year, from sports to culture to contact with nature. There is also space for the typical Ladin cuisine.
